SHT21湿度传感器介绍
SHT21是一款由瑞士Sensirion公司生产的数字温湿度传感器。作为SHT系列产品的一部分,SHT21传感器具备高精度、高稳定性以及低功耗等优异性能,广泛应用于环境监测、物联网(IoT)、智能家居等多个领域。本篇文章将详细介绍SHT21湿度传感器的工作原理、主要参数、特性、应用及其使用方法。
1. SHT21传感器概述
SHT21传感器是一款集成了温度和湿度传感功能的数字传感器。它能够提供精确的湿度和温度数据,通过I2C接口进行通信。SHT21采用了数字化输出方式,避免了传统模拟传感器因噪声影响而带来的误差,提供了更为稳定可靠的测量结果。
该传感器基于Sensirion的CMOSens技术,这项技术将传感器元件、模拟前端电路、数字信号处理器及I2C接口集成在同一个芯片上,实现了高性能与小型化的完美结合。SHT21不仅能够精确测量湿度和温度,还能在较宽的工作温度范围内稳定工作,适应多种应用场合。
2. 工作原理
SHT21湿度传感器的工作原理依赖于其内部的电容式湿度传感器和热敏电阻温度传感器。湿度传感器通过电容变化来感知空气中的水蒸气含量,而温度传感器则通过热敏电阻对环境温度的变化作出响应。两个传感器的数据通过内部的模拟-数字转换器(ADC)转换为数字信号,再通过I2C接口传输给外部设备。
湿度传感器的工作原理如下:
电容式湿度感应:SHT21的湿度传感器由一个特殊的电容元件构成,电容值会随着空气中水蒸气的含量变化而变化。当空气中的湿度增加时,传感器电容的值增大;反之,湿度降低时,电容值也会减少。
温度感应:SHT21的温度传感器采用热敏电阻(NTC型),其电阻值随着温度的变化而发生变化。传感器通过检测电阻的变化来推算出周围环境的温度。
数字输出:SHT21传感器通过集成的ADC将模拟信号转换为数字信号,并通过I2C接口传输到主控系统。传感器的数字输出格式符合I2C通信协议,可以直接与微控制器或其他数字设备进行通信。
3. 主要参数
SHT21传感器的性能优异,主要参数如下:
测量范围:
湿度测量范围:0%RH到100%RH(相对湿度)
温度测量范围:-40°C到+125°C
精度:
湿度精度:±3%RH(在20%RH到80%RH范围内)
温度精度:±0.3°C(在-10°C到+85°C范围内)
分辨率:
湿度分辨率:0.04%RH
温度分辨率:0.01°C
响应时间:
湿度响应时间:约6秒(63%的响应)
温度响应时间:约2秒(63%的响应)
功耗:
工作电压:2.1V到3.6V
工作电流:约2.5mA(测量模式下),待机电流:约0.01µA
接口类型:I2C(支持主设备模式)
尺寸:SHT21传感器的尺寸非常小巧,典型封装为3.9mm × 3.8mm × 1.1mm。
4. 传感器特点
SHT21传感器因其多种优点,在环境监测和智能设备中广泛使用。其主要特点包括:
高精度和稳定性:SHT21具有优异的湿度和温度测量精度,尤其在湿度范围为20%RH到80%RH时,精度可达±3%RH。此外,温度的测量精度可达±0.3°C。这些优异的性能使得SHT21在要求高精度数据的应用场合中表现出色。
数字化输出:SHT21通过I2C接口输出数字信号,避免了模拟传感器常见的信号衰减和噪声干扰,提供更加稳定和可靠的数据。
低功耗:SHT21的工作电流较低,非常适合电池供电的应用。它具有低待机功耗,在无操作时功耗极小,延长了电池的使用寿命。
小巧的封装:SHT21的尺寸非常紧凑,适合嵌入式设计,能够在空间有限的设备中轻松集成。其封装形式适合表面贴装(SMD),便于自动化生产。
快速响应时间:SHT21的湿度和温度传感器响应时间较短,可以在快速变化的环境中实时获取精确数据。
抗干扰能力强:SHT21传感器的设计具有较强的抗电磁干扰(EMI)能力,确保在复杂的工作环境中仍能保持稳定的性能。
5. 应用领域
由于SHT21湿度传感器具有高精度、小体积、低功耗等特点,它广泛应用于多个领域,具体包括:
环境监测: SHT21传感器常被用于空气质量监测系统中,测量环境湿度和温度。这对于气象站、室内空气质量检测、农业气候监控等场合具有重要意义。通过实时监测湿度和温度变化,能够对环境进行有效控制和调节。
智能家居: 在智能家居领域,SHT21可以用来监控家居环境中的温湿度变化。例如,在智能空调、加湿器、除湿器等设备中,SHT21传感器被用来实时监控空气湿度,从而调节设备的工作状态,保持室内舒适的环境。
物联网(IoT): SHT21传感器广泛应用于物联网设备中,能够为智能设备提供温湿度数据。例如,智能仓储系统、智能农业设备、智能温室等系统均使用SHT21传感器来感知周围环境,做出相应决策。
医疗健康: 在医疗健康领域,SHT21可以用于温湿度控制系统,确保医疗设备存放环境符合温湿度要求。它还可以用于监测病房、手术室等场所的环境条件,以保证患者健康。
工业控制: 在工业自动化领域,SHT21传感器用于测量设备和生产环境中的温湿度。通过精确的湿度和温度监控,帮助企业提高生产效率,优化设备运行状态,避免设备过热或因湿度过大而导致故障。
气象设备: 由于其高精度、可靠性,SHT21传感器在便携式气象设备中也有广泛应用,尤其是在需要实时、精确获取环境温湿度数据的场合。它能够为气象预报、灾害预警等提供有力的数据支持。
6. 使用方法与接口
SHT21传感器通过I2C接口进行数据通信。用户可以通过控制器或微处理器与SHT21传感器进行通信,获取温湿度数据。
连接方式: SHT21通过I2C接口连接到主控设备。I2C通信协议要求两个引脚——SCL(时钟信号)和SDA(数据线),连接到主控设备的相应引脚。SHT21工作时,主控设备发送命令至SHT21传感器,请求温湿度数据,传感器则返回数字信号。
读取数据: 通过I2C协议,主控设备可以请求SHT21传感器返回湿度和温度数据。数据返回后,主控设备需要进行数据解析和单位转换,最终得到湿度和温度的数值。SHT21传感器提供的输出数据经过校准,用户无需进行复杂的校准工作。
初始化与配置:SHT21传感器初始化与配置非常简便。使用I2C协议时,通常需要向SHT21发送一个初始化命令,设置传感器的工作模式。例如,设置测量周期、选择温湿度测量或者设定待机模式等。之后,传感器会根据用户设定的命令进行数据采集,并通过I2C接口将数据传送到主控设备。